IAEP embraces
a broad understanding of environmental philosophy, including not
only environmental ethics, but also environmental aesthetics, ontology,
and theology, the philosophy of science, ecofeminism, and the philosophy
of technology.
For IAEP, environmental philosophy
is both rigorous and engaged. It encourages joint meetings with
other academic disciplines and supports interdisciplinary student
internships.
IAEP welcomes a diversity of approaches
to environmental issues, including the many schools of Continental
Philosophy, the history of philosophy, and the tradition of American
Philosophy.
